Description

Soft tissue grafting can be a significant factor in retaining dentition or preparing a site for implant placement. Variations in the method of grafting can enhance or diminish the result. Tips acquired from years of experience can make this a simple and predictable procedure with dependable outcomes that can be integrated into any practice.

 

Learning Objectives: At completion of this presentation, participants should be able to:

 

1. Determine whether there is justification for soft tissue grafting

2. Perform expedited procedures that have a very low risk of failure

3. Make small alterations that improve the appearance of the grafted site

4. Learn methods of making the procedure relatively pain-free.
